Pinoy maids in Singapore to get pay hike, minimum wage to increase to US$400

philSTAR.com, 19 Dec 2012
MANILA, Philippines - Filipino household service workers (HSWs) in Singapore will soon enjoy a pay hike, the Department of Labor and Employment said yesterday.
Labor Secretary Rosalinda Baldoz said employers in Singapore have agreed to upgrade the pay scales of HSWs to a minimum of $400.
On top of the minimum $400 salary for HSWs, recruiters also agreed to a no placement fee policy before departure.
Employers also promised to provide the HSWs three meals a day, one day off and at least seven hours of uninterrupted sleep. Full story
